dpaa_eth: try to move the data in place for the A050385 erratum
authorCamelia Groza <camelia.groza@nxp.com>
Thu, 4 Feb 2021 16:49:28 +0000 (18:49 +0200)
committerJak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org>
Sat, 6 Feb 2021 03:58:34 +0000 (19:58 -0800)
The XDP frame's headroom might be large enough to accommodate the
xdpf backpointer as well as shifting the data to an aligned address.

Try this first before resorting to allocating a new buffer and copying
the data.
